Qualcomm introduced Snapdragon 6 Gen 4 – AI chip for inexpensive smartphones
In middle class smartphones, functions of artificial intelligence (AI) will more often appear – thanks to the new Qualcomm processor. This is reported by the publication of Engadget.
The American company introduced the Snapdragon 6 Gen 4 chip – the first middle -class model with AI support. Qualcomm said that the processor will suppress external noise during conversations, use advanced voice assistants and much more. The model also supports Int4, which will support AI services on compact devices.
The performance of the central processor Snapdragon 6 Gen 4 is 11 percent higher than that of the predecessor. An increase in the power of the graphic processor is 29 percent. The chip for inexpensive phones should also provide an increase in the data rate through Wi-Fi and 5G.
“All this means that Android users do not have to spend money on flagship devices to get the latest AI functions and decent speed,” the journalists of the publication noted. Qualcomm said that the first chip Snapdragon 6 Gen 4 will receive Oppo and Honor, which integrate it into their smartphones.
